Output 4662494f67fa8dc7b1efb65838579915c49b707cee2515a2da45b22e58f90fa5:2

value
27929059
script pubkey
OP_0 OP_PUSHBYTES_20 6c68bfbbe61b0adcb4915f5c9f56cc75b6dec1f5
address
bc1qd35tlwlxrv9dedy3tawf74kvwkmdas04wlvstq
transaction
4662494f67fa8dc7b1efb65838579915c49b707cee2515a2da45b22e58f90fa5
spent
true